Sobre la familia


R41 Elite is a script typeface — not derived from a geometric framework but created with tools such as brushes that allow for greater imagination and freedom. Created by Aldo Novarese in 1969 for the Nebiolo Foundry in Turin, it is an elegant typeface that is pleasant to read and easy to use. Although the letters are separate, the optical sensation of calligraphic continuity remains intact. Excessive contrast between thin and thick strokes is avoided to ensure good legibility even in long texts. The design is deliberately simple, so as not to subject the typeface to ephemeral trends. Designed to last, Elite is ideal for all those projects where overly classic and severe typefaces can be replaced by a lively yet sober script (business cards, letterheads, various announcements, invitations, greetings, wedding invitations, covers, title pages, etc.).

Acerca de Reber R41

Reber R41 is an Italian company founded in Spresiano, Treviso, in 1960 by Renato Bernardi, inventor of his own method of dry transfer type, and still run by his family. Since 1969, R41 has produced dry-transfer adaptations of iconic designs from Nebiolo Type Foundry, including its most experimental creations designed for the booming Italian advertising industry. Designer Aldo Novarese, who retired from Nebiolo in the early ’70s, worked with Reber R41 for years afterward designing brands, catalogues, advertising and of course…typefaces. Now Reber R41 provides new digitizations of the work of Novarese and Nebiolo of Turin, brought together in a unique collection that preserves the best of historic Italian typography of the twentieth century.
